chris sideways Posted August 6, 2002 Share Posted August 6, 2002 Thinking of fitting a aero screen to my car as i think they look great but do they make any differance to the performance of the car "ie" less drag or is it just a looks thing,also once fitted can i still fit the old window back on after taking the aero screen off. thanks. will maskell Posted August 6, 2002 Share Posted August 6, 2002 hi chris, yes they do look the dogs,I believe they do increase top speed(less drag!!)but that could be argued & probrably will . regards fitting your full screen back on you prob could but you would have **** loads of holes everywhere,but why would you want to put it back on!!just sell it to some southern softie do it,go on,you know you want to cheers will p.s;I take it yours is a wide bodied car?? chris sideways Posted August 6, 2002 Author Share Posted August 6, 2002 Hi Will Yes my car is a wide body when you say loads of holes every where does that mean its hard to fit?I see you have one on your car do you use a helmet on the road or can you get away with sunny's,do they come in one colour or do your have to order it to suit? will maskell Posted August 6, 2002 Share Posted August 6, 2002 chris, holes wise i meant the holes will be in different places for each item. difficulty;i found fitting one off these the hardest part off the build but was worth the hassle,just takes a bit off time!! on the road i use a bit off everything some times sunnies with beanie hat.oakley goggles with beanie hat & on recent nurburgring trip full face helmet was called for.none off which are a problem they come gel coated in your choice off colour. all the best will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
